OverviewAttention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a condition that can make everyday tasks-such as staying focused, managing time, and organizing responsibilities-more difficult. Individuals with ADHD may experience restlessness or act impulsively, which can influence their performance at school, at work, and in personal relationships. However, it is important to remember that many people share these experiences, and a range of helpful strategies and support systems are available. Many who live with ADHD find practical solutions, like setting reminders, breaking larger tasks into smaller, manageable steps, and seeking guidance from professionals through therapy, advice, or medication. Having a network of supportive friends, family, or teachers can be incredibly beneficial. With the right tools and encouragement, individuals with ADHD can thrive and fully enjoy life.
